Item 8.01 Other Events.
On February 24, 2009, the Company issued a press release announcing that its principal subsidiary, The Dayton Power and Light Company (“DP&L”), has entered into a settlement agreement with the staff of the Public Utilities Commission of Ohio (“PUCO”) and various intervening parties with respect to DP&L’s electric security plan that was filed with the PUCO in October 2008 in compliance with Ohio’s new energy law. The settlement is subject to approval by the PUCO. A copy of the press release is furnished as Exhibit 99.3 to this Current Report on Form 8-K.
